All employers today need to adhere to the Equality Act of 2010. You should consult with employees that may have a disability or disability groups to fully understand their requirements, and ensure that appropriate adjustments are put in place.
Of course, once you understand what may need to change in the workplace to help improve conditions for anyone with a disability, you should also consider which disabled access signs you need and where they should be displayed.
Please consult the Disability rights section of the Government website for more information on reasonable adjustments in the workplace.
